On 1 Oct 97 at 21:51, Robert McNulty wrote:
> What does Delorie mean by Free Compiler? Do I have to pay money to
> use it or is it freedom in using it? (What I mean is can the
> programs created from it be freely distributed? Can i send you a
> program I created from my computer and not pay any money for sending
> it? If I have to pay for it, how much does it cost?
You do NOT have to pay any money (though DJ would never say no to a
donation). Your programs generated by djgpp are freely distributable
as you see fit (watch out for the GPL and LGPL, see the FAQ for more
details), with no money invovled. You can even charge for your
programs if you wish (again, check out the GPL and LGPL, though they
do not stop you from charging).
